How long we keep your personal information

We will only keep your personal information for as long as necessary to provide you with membership services. Unless you ask us not to, we will review and delete your personal information where you have not renewed your membership with us for one year. One year retention does not apply if you have requested advocacy support services (see below).

Should you request advocacy services your data used to process your advocacy case and provide support will be kept for a period of five years. This is due to the nature of ME (Myalgic Encephalomyelitis) affecting wellbeing and memory. Individuals may have difficulty in recalling information required to process future cases and support services. This helps us to provide better advocacy services without having to reobtain information to provide and process your advocacy services and cases after a period of inactivity. After a period of five years of inactivity with advocacy services we will attempt to contact you to confirm if you would like us to retain the data for longer. This provides reassurance that you won’t need to provide required information should you required any future advocacy support.

We will hold personal data for members’ who are elected onto our Management Committee for the period of their election and for purposes of confirming their identity thereafter and how long they served on the Management Committee. Management Committee nominees’ names will be reproduced for election purposes within our AGM Ballot Booklet and their names and short bio will be published on our website.

Annual accounts and payment details will be kept for a period of seven years. Please refer to PayPal and MY BT Donate policy’s if you used these services to donate to find their current retentions periods for processing payments.
